State Establishes Forest Crime Information Center

Bhopal  —  In continuum of its efforts to curb wildlife related crime in the state, the Madhya Pradesh state government has set up a Forest Crime Information Center.

Working round-the-clock, the center may be dialed in toll free (155312) with any complaints related to illegal felling, theft, poaching or fire.

The center was established at the behest of Forest Minister Sartaj Singh, who since his recent induction to the state cabinet has sought greater public cooperation to combat forest and wildlife crime in the state.
